Factory Town - Special Events Sales Manager

Live Nation Entertainment is a leading company in the event production industry, known for its innovative music festivals and events. The Special Events Sales Manager will be responsible for driving revenue through the sale of private and corporate events, managing client engagement, sales strategies, and relationships with key stakeholders.

Responsibilities

Aggressively manage revenue generation in line with individual sales goals set by leadership
Track and report financial performance by market segment on a monthly and quarterly basis
Assist leadership in developing annual sales and revenue plans across all key market segments: Conventions, Association, INcentive, Tour & Travel, Corporate, Social, SMERF, DMC, etc
Contribute to forecasting, budgeting and financial reconciliation to support department planning and overall profitability
Consistently meet or exceed monthly and annual sales targets
Proactively identify, solicit, and secure new business through outbound sales efforts
Develop and maintain a robust, segmented pipeline of prospective clients across relevant industries
Respond to all inbound inquiries within 24 hours, maintaining a high level of client service and professionalism
Leverage CRM tools to manage contacts, track opportunities, and ensure accurate documentation
Manage full sales cycle: lead generation, proposals, site visits, contract negotiations, pre-event planning, and post-event follow-up
Generate Special Events Orders (SEOs), contracts, proposals and event documentation in a timely and accurate manner
Ensure seamless hand-off to internal operations teams while maintaining oversight of event execution
Sever as the primary point of contact for high-profile or complex events as needed
Support leadership in preparing strategic reports: calendars, trackers, forecasts, monthly initiatives, and SEO updates
Partner with internal stakeholders (operations, marketing, production/ops) to ensure alignment across event execution
Ensure staffing levels and event resources are properly coordinated with the Production/Facility Management
Recruit, hire, onboard and train various team members as needed
Act as brand ambassador internally and externally, promoting venue standards and company values
Build strong relationships local officials, hotels, professional associations, and vendor partners
Represent the venue at tradeshows, networking events, and client entertainment opportunities
Assist in the development and upkeep of sales collateral, online listings, and assigned social media platforms

Required

5+ years of experience in sales, with at least 2 years in a managerial capacity within hospitality, events or catering
Strong understanding of the local and regional market
Excellent communication, negotiation, and relationship management skills
Existing relationships within the private event industry and buyers
Experience selling in diverse event environments including social, nonprofit and entertainment segments
Strong organizational skills with attention to detail, timelines, and accuracy
Professional appearance and demeanor; comfortable interacting with executive-level clients
Must be available to work flexible hours including nights, weekends and holidays
Must be able to tolerate loud noise levels & busy environments
May work in drastic temperature climates
Must be willing to travel to work during holidays, evening and weekend hours, as required, to meet deadlines

Preferred

Bachelor's degree in hospitality management, business, marketing or related field preferred
